Color Schemes: Explain the principles of color theory and how to choose complementary or contrasting colors for a cohesive look.
Color Schemes: Balancing Contrast and Harmony for a Cohesive Sofa
When selecting sofa pillows, understanding the principles of color theory is essential for creating a harmonious and visually appealing space. It’s not just about choosing colors you like; it’s about balancing contrast and harmony to achieve a cohesive look.
Complementary Colors:
Complementary col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el, creating a vibrant contrast that can energize and excite the space. For example, pairing a bright blue pillow with an orange one can create a dynamic and eye-catching focal point.
Analogous Colors:
Analogous colors are adjacent to each other on the color wheel, resulting in a more subtle and calming effect. Combining pillows in shades of green, from emerald to olive, can create a serene and inviting atmosphere.
Monochromatic Scheme:
A monochromatic color scheme uses different shades of the same color, providing a sleek and sophisticated look. Variations in texture and pattern can add visual interest and depth to this monochromatic palette.
Triadic Colors:
Triadic colors are evenly spaced on the color wheel, forming a triangle. This combination creates a balanced and dynamic effect, balancing contrast and harmony. A trio of red, yellow, and blue pillows can inject vibrancy and character into a neutral sofa.
Warm vs. Cool Colors:
Warm colors (reds, oranges, yellows) energize and invigorate, while cool colors (blues, greens, purples) calm and relax. Consider the overall mood you want to create in your space when choosing between warm and cool hues.
By understanding the principles of color theory, you can select sofa pillows that not only enhance the aesthetics of your decor but also create a cohesive and inviting atmosphere that reflects your personal style.

Size and Shape: Finding the Perfect Fit for Your Sofa
When choosing pillows for your sofa, it’s crucial to consider their size and shape to ensure a harmonious and comfortable seating experience. The back height and seating depth of your sofa are key factors to keep in mind.
For sofas with high backs, larger pillows with a rectangular or square shape provide good support and fill the space effectively. Low-back sofas, on the other hand, can accommodate smaller pillows with more playful shapes, such as round or triangular ones.
The seating depth also influences the choice of pillow size. Deep sofas require larger pillows to fill the gap between the backrest and the user’s back. Alternatively, shallow sofas are better suited for smaller pillows that don’t overhang excessively.
Remember, the goal is to create a balanced look that complements the sofa’s size and shape. By considering these factors, you can select pillows that not only enhance the aesthetics but also provide optimal comfort for lounging, reading, or taking a nap.

Hypoallergenic Pillows and a Healthier Home
If you’re like most people, you spend a significant amount of time on your sofa, whether it’s for relaxing, watching TV, or reading. As such, it’s important to make your sofa as comfortable and inviting as possible, and one of the best ways to do that is with pillows. However, if you’re prone to allergies, you need to be careful about the type of pillows you choose.
Traditional pillows can trap dust mites, pet dander, and other allergens, which can trigger sneezing, congestion, and other allergy symptoms. Hypoallergenic pillows are designed to minimize these allergens and create a healthier and more comfortable seating environment.
Hypoallergenic pillows are made with special materials that resist dust mites and other allergens. They are also often machine-washable, making it easy to keep them clean and fresh. If you suffer from allergies, hypoallergenic pillows can make your home a more comfortable and healthier place to be.
Here are a few things to keep in mind when shopping for hypoallergenic pillows:
-
Look for pillows that are made with hypoallergenic materials. Some of the most common hypoallergenic materials include:
- Polyester
- Down alternative
- Memory foam
- Latex
-
Choose pillows that are machine-washable. This will make it easy to keep your pillows clean and free of allergens.
-
Consider pillows with a zippered cover. This will allow you to remove the cover and wash it separately, which can be helpful if you have severe allergies.
By following these tips, you can find hypoallergenic pillows that will help you create a healthier and more comfortable home.
Durability: Pillows That Endure the Wear and Tear of Time
Selecting durable pillows is crucial for maintaining the comfort and aesthetic appeal of your sofa. Several factors contribute to the longevity of a pillow, each playing a pivotal role in ensuring it withstands the test of time.
Fabric Quality: The Keystone of Durability
The fabric you choose for your pillow covers has a direct impact on its durability. Natural fibers like cotton, linen, and wool are breathable and resistant to wear and tear, making them excellent choices for long-lasting pillows. Synthetic fabrics like polyester and nylon are also durable, but they may not be as breathable as natural fibers.
Construction: The Art of Crafting Long-Lasting Pillows
The construction of a pillow significantly influences its durability. Pillows with well-made seams and reinforced stitching are less likely to tear or come apart, even after frequent use. Zippered pillow covers allow for easy cleaning, further extending the pillow’s lifespan.
Filling Material: The Secret to Comfort and Support
The filling material of a pillow determines its comfort and durability. Down and feather fillings provide luxurious softness, but they require regular fluffing and may not be suitable for allergy sufferers. Memory foam and fiberfill are hypoallergenic and provide excellent support, making them ideal for those seeking durability and comfort.
Cleaning and Maintaining Your Pillows for a Longer Lifespan
Pillows are an essential part of any sofa, adding comfort, style, and personality to your living space. To keep your pillows looking their best and extending their lifespan, it’s important to give them proper care and maintenance.
Regular Cleaning:
Regular cleaning is crucial to remove dust, dirt, and spills that accumulate over time. Vacuum your pillows regularly using the upholstery attachment to remove loose particles. For spills, act quickly and blot the area with a clean cloth to absorb as much moisture as possible. Avoid rubbing, as this can spread the stain.
Spot Cleaning:
For stubborn stains, use a mild detergent diluted in water. Test the solution on an inconspicuous area first to ensure it doesn’t damage the fabric. Apply the solution to a clean cloth and dab the stain gently. Rinse with a damp cloth and allow the pillow to air dry.
Deep Cleaning:
For a thorough cleaning, some pillows can be machine-washed. Check the care label for specific instructions. Use cold water and a gentle detergent, and avoid using bleach. Fluff the pillows in the dryer on a low heat setting to maintain their shape.
Other Maintenance Tips:
- Plump and rotate your pillows regularly to prevent uneven wear and tear.
- Air out pillows regularly in a well-ventilated area to prevent odors.
- Protect outdoor pillows from rain and UV rays by storing them indoors when not in use.
- Consider using pillow covers to protect pillows from spills and wear, making them easier to clean and maintain.
By following these cleaning and maintenance tips, you can keep your pillows looking their best for years to come. A well-maintained pillow not only enhances the comfort of your sofa but also adds a touch of style and personality to your home.

Finding Affordable Sofa Pillows That Match Your Style and Budget
Choosing the perfect sofa pillows can elevate your living space, adding comfort, style, and functionality. However, finding pillows that meet your needs without breaking the bank can be a challenge. Here’s a guide to help you navigate the price spectrum and discover affordable options.
Understanding Price Differences
The price of sofa pillows varies widely depending on factors like:
- Fabric: Natural materials like linen and silk are typically more expensive than synthetic fabrics like polyester and microfiber.
- Construction: Pillows with intricate stitching and custom embellishments tend to cost more than simpler designs.
- Size and Shape: Larger and uniquely shaped pillows typically require more fabric and labor, increasing their price.
Tips for Finding Affordable Pillows
- Shop Off-Season: Retailers often offer discounts on seasonal items, so look for sales on pillows after major holidays.
- Consider Discount Stores: Big box stores like IKEA and Target offer a wide selection of affordable pillows in various styles.
- DIY: If you have crafting skills, you can create your own pillows using inexpensive materials like fabric scraps or old throw blankets.
- Check Online Marketplaces: Websites like Amazon and Etsy offer a competitive marketplace where you can compare prices and find deals.
- Look for Sales and Promotions: Sign up for email lists and follow retailers on social media to receive notifications about special offers and discounts.
Remember:
- You don’t have to sacrifice style for affordability. Look for classic designs and neutral colors that can complement any decor.
- Mix and match different textures and patterns to create a cohesive look without spending a fortune.
- Invest in pillows with durable materials that can withstand regular use and cleaning.
By following these tips, you can find stylish and comfortable sofa pillows that fit your budget and elevate your living space without overspending.
